Recognizing Toxicity

Toxic relationships come in many forms, and they can slowly erode your self-esteem, peace of mind, and overall well-being. Whether it's a friend who constantly belittles you, a family member who drains your energy, or a romantic partner who is emotionally abusive, it's essential to recognize when a relationship has turned toxic.

Setting Boundaries: The Path to Self-Respect

The Importance of Boundaries

Boundaries are like the lines on a map; they define where you end and others begin. They are a fundamental aspect of any healthy relationship, enabling you to protect your emotional and mental well-being while maintaining a respectful and balanced connection with others.

Self-Respect through Boundaries

Establishing and enforcing boundaries is an act of self-respect. It communicates your worth and reinforces the idea that you deserve to be treated with kindness, consideration, and love. It's a powerful tool in your journey to let go of toxic relationships.

FAQs About Letting Go of Toxic Relationships

1. Is it okay to end a toxic relationship, even if it's with a family member or a long-time friend?

Yes, it is absolutely okay to end a toxic relationship, regardless of the nature or history of the connection. Your well-being should always come first.

2. How do I know if a relationship is toxic?

A relationship is toxic if it consistently brings pain, suffering, or disrespect into your life. Trust your instincts and seek support from trusted friends or professionals if you're unsure.

3. What if I can't completely let go of a toxic relationship due to certain circumstances?

If complete detachment is not possible, set clear boundaries and limit your time and energy spent in the presence of the toxic individual. Protect yourself as much as you can.

4. How can I cope with the pain of letting go?

Coping with the pain of letting go involves self-care, seeking support from others, and allowing yourself to grieve the loss. Remember that healing takes time, and it's okay to seek professional help if needed.

5. Can letting go of toxic relationships lead to loneliness?

In the short term, it may feel lonely, but letting go of toxic relationships opens the door for healthier connections to enter your life. Loneliness can be a temporary phase on the path to healing and growth.

FAQs About Personal Growth and Letting Go

1. How do I rebuild my self-esteem after ending a toxic relationship?

Rebuilding self-esteem takes time and self-compassion. Engage in self-care, set achievable goals, and seek support from friends or professionals.

2. Can personal growth occur without letting go of toxic relationships?

Personal growth can occur within toxic relationships, but it may be limited and hindered. Letting go often accelerates the growth process.

3. What are some signs that I am on the path to personal growth after ending a toxic relationship?

Signs of personal growth include increased self-awareness, improved self-esteem, a sense of empowerment, and a more positive outlook on life.

4. Is it possible to rekindle a relationship with someone after personal growth has occurred?

Rekindling a relationship with someone who has caused you harm is possible but should be approached with caution. It requires open communication, willingness to change, and a commitment to healthier dynamics.

5. Can personal growth be sustained over time?

Personal growth is an ongoing journey. It can be sustained through continuous self-reflection, self-care, and a commitment to your own well-being.
